Source One Real Estate and Crown Point Mayor David Uran’s Office of Special Events have announced a brand new festival, Dog Days of Summer, set for August 23, from 1 to 9 p.m. at the Lake County Fairgrounds. All event proceeds are solely dedicated to the Crown Point Animal Shelter Fund.

Six northern Indiana businesses were among the 50 companies from 17 Indiana counties named to the second annual field of “Companies to Watch.”

A feasibility study looking at commuter rail extensions to Lowell and Valparaiso has been shelved while officials search for ways to lower projected costs.
The St. Joseph County Council approved a trio of income tax increases by a 5-4 vote.
Prompt Ambulance is expanding into South Bend, IN.
